Warning Signs You Need Portable Pump Water Extraction

Catching the warning signs of water damage early can save you a lot of money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Our team has identified several key indicators that you may need Portable Pump Water Extraction in your home or business. Look out for these signs and don’t wait to contact us if you notice any of them: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your home or office can be a sign of hidden water damage. These smells are often caused by mold or mildew and can show a larger issue that needs professional attention. Don’t ignore these odors as they can lead to more severe problems if left unchecked.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a clear indication of water damage. This type of damage can occur when water seeps into the flooring materials, causing them to warp or buckle.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age and potential health risks.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ration can be a sign of water damage in your home or office. These stains may appear on walls, ceilings, or floors and can show a hidden leak or other issue. Don’t delay in addressing these stains, as they can lead to more severe problems if left unchecked.

Excessive Moisture or Humidity

Excessive moisture or humidity in your home or office can be a sign of hidden water damage. This can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and other issues if left unchecked. Act quickly to address this issue and pr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ks in your home or office can be a clear indication of a larger issue that needs professional attention. Don’t wait to address this issue, as it can lead to more severe problems and higher repair costs.

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ost in Struthers, OH

The cost of Portable Pump Water Extraction can vary depending on several factors, including the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in Struthers, OH. These estimates are based on real-world data and should give you a general idea of what to expect. Keep in mind that ex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you know what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Equipment Rental $200 – $1,000 Duration of rental, type of equipment
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Complexity of damage, size of affected area
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$10,000 Scope of work, materials needed
Disinfection and Sanitization $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
